Trip Overview

Traveling from Robinson to Peoria covers 198.8 miles and typically takes about 4 hours and 4 minutes. Because this is a manageable distance through the Illinois Midwest, it works perfectly as a straightforward one-day trip. You will primarily navigate via IL 130, I-57, and I-74 to complete your journey. Budgeting approximately $30 for fuel should cover your needs for the duration of the drive. While the route is simple enough to handle in a single push, planning for one planned stop will make the time behind the wheel much more comfortable. Whether you are heading north for business or a change of scenery, this highway-focused transit is predictable and efficient.

Founded 1680

Peoria is a city in Illinois and the county seat of Peoria County. It serves as a regional hub for the primarily rural and agricultural center of the state. Peoria is a small but diverse city of approximately 115,000 people that anchors a three-county metropolitan area of nearly 400,000.
